Abstract

In-depth interviewing and participant observation were used to study how social workers influence birth mothers in the pregnancy counseling process. According to the workers (1) they have little or no influence over a birth mother''s decision to keep or relinquish her baby and (2) the decision to keep or relinquish is largely dependent on the birth mother''s emotional capacity to tolerate the loss of the child.
